1961 Austin 7 | 2008 Mercedes-Benz G | |
Make | Austin | Mercedes-Benz |
Model | 7 | G |
Year Released | 1961 | 2008 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 848 cc | 2688 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 5 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 33 HP | 154 HP |
Engine RPM | 5500 RPM | 3800 RPM |
Torque | 60 Nm | 400 Nm |
Torque RPM | 3600 RPM | 1800 RPM |
Engine Compression Ratio | 8.3:1 | 18.0:1 |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Diesel |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 3 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 610 kg | 2275 kg |
Vehicle Length | 3060 mm | 4230 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1450 mm | 1770 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1360 mm | 1940 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2040 mm | 2410 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 72 L | 96 L |
